Using handy features

Using auto setting (Auto setting)

This function sets up the projector to the optimum state for
each type of the input signal by using simple operations.
1
Press the AUTO SET button.
The Auto setting menu appears.
2
Press the AUTO SET button again.
The menu item is automatically adjusted/set.
For computer input, the
icon will appear during
processing.
Note
• Auto adjustment/setting may not be performed correctly for input signals other than
those supported by the projector

Zooming out the images

.
This equipment is provided with the digital zoom (electric zoom) (100-80%) capability in
addition to the optical zoom.
You can use the digital zoom in applications where the optical zoom is not applicable
due to some physical reasons for installations (Note, however, that digitally zoomed
display suffers from some degradation).
1
Press the ZOOM – button.
Each time the ZOOM – button is pressed, the
image is reduced in size.
